Australia joined the US, the EU, Canada, Germany and Britain to force sanctions on Russia after Moscow ordered troops into different regions in Ukraine. Australia will instantly start putting sanctions on Russian individuals who it believes were responsible for its actions against Ukraine, Australian PM Scott Morrison said in a media briefing.
